Dancing Dancing with legendary devil, Friday afternoon, Only on Friday, Thursday, Ran along too soon, All consuming, Tension relief, Captures all remaining grief! Strips me bare without a care, Peace together in piece, Sorts everything, Tries to make it right! As strutting fellow pranced, In rays of sunlight draped, Protected, You and I in one, Our Pas De Deux delight, Whirls on, In panoramas bright, Found myself in cupid's light, A scope of vision unexpected! Enthroned as poets lady wise, Bathing in his darkness! Encountering my white! By ladylivvi1 © 2013 ladylivvi1 (All rights reserved)
